自定义UITableViewCell前导对齐到右侧细节单元格

时间:2015-07-13 15:49:23

标签: ios swift uitableview tableviewcell

我正在使用UITableView静态UITableViewCells。我正在使用自定义单元格和正确的细节单元格。我想让自定义单元格中的UILabel与右侧详细信息单元格中的UILabel对齐。

我在Interface Builder中进行了检查,并在右侧详细信息单元格中显示UILabel,使x原点为15.在自定义UITableViewCell中,我将UILabel设置为具有相同的起始x原点。这适用于iPhone,但是当我在iPad上加载应用程序时,它们没有正确对齐。右侧细节单元格内的UILabel似乎具有约18的起始x原点。

我能做些什么来确保UILabel在Interface Builder中具有相同的前导对齐,或者我是否需要根据设备类型以编程方式设置约束?

1 个答案:

答案 0 :(得分:0)

不幸的是,我认为没有一种简单的方法可以根据Apple的预制单元格进行约束。您可能不得不手动编写约束,或者另一个选项是自己实现正确的细节单元格,并使约束与其他自定义单元格相同。